When you notice a nasty clog or your rest room won’t flush, your finest guess is to pour in some hot water. You can flip the tap in your rest room sink or tub to the most nicely liked setting or heat the water up a bit on the range, but don’t let the water get to boiling level. Pour it down the drain and let it sit for a few minutes to see if it loosens the clog. You’ll know in case your efforts had been profitable if you see the water begin to drain. In many cases, scorching water is sufficient to break up no matter is inflicting the backup. Small plumbing repairs like unclogging a toilet or fixing a leaky faucet sometimes cost $125 to $350. Larger jobs corresponding to repairing the plumbing on a pipe leak, you’ll pay about $500 to $800. Though convenient, liquid drain cleaners aren’t all the time the best resolution to clearing clogs in your sinks, tubs, and showers. These merchandise can injury pipes and septic techniques, and don’t at all times work on the hardest clogs.
